Message ID | 1407406499-11658-2-git-send-email-anders.roxell@linaro.org |
---|---|
State | Accepted |
Commit | 02530f8ac36f6b7271013b3437ba20cd9806d18b |
Headers | show |
On 08/07/2014 01:14 PM, Anders Roxell wrote: > Signed-off-by: Anders Roxell <anders.roxell@linaro.org> > --- > platform/Makefile.inc | 11 +++++++++++ > platform/linux-dpdk/Makefile.am | 11 +---------- > platform/linux-generic/Makefile.am | 11 +---------- > platform/linux-keystone2/Makefile.am | 11 +---------- > 4 files changed, 14 insertions(+), 30 deletions(-) > create mode 100644 platform/Makefile.inc Acked-by: Taras Kondratiuk <taras.kondratiuk@linaro.org>
Merged, thanks! Maxim. On 08/07/2014 02:14 PM, Anders Roxell wrote: > Signed-off-by: Anders Roxell <anders.roxell@linaro.org> > --- > platform/Makefile.inc | 11 +++++++++++ > platform/linux-dpdk/Makefile.am | 11 +---------- > platform/linux-generic/Makefile.am | 11 +---------- > platform/linux-keystone2/Makefile.am | 11 +---------- > 4 files changed, 14 insertions(+), 30 deletions(-) > create mode 100644 platform/Makefile.inc > > diff --git a/platform/Makefile.inc b/platform/Makefile.inc > new file mode 100644 > index 0000000..6ffa2ad > --- /dev/null > +++ b/platform/Makefile.inc > @@ -0,0 +1,11 @@ > +LIB = $(top_builddir)/lib > + > +dist_pkgdata_DATA = $(LIB)/libodp.la > + > +pkgconfigdir = $(libdir)/pkgconfig > +p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c > + > +.PHONY: pkgconfig/libodp.pc > + > +VPATH = $(srcdir) $(builddir) > +lib_LTLIBRARIES = $(LIB)/libodp.la > diff --git a/platform/linux-dpdk/Makefile.am b/platform/linux-dpdk/Makefile.am > index 37150f2..fb87d41 100644 > --- a/platform/linux-dpdk/Makefile.am > +++ b/platform/linux-dpdk/Makefile.am > @@ -1,12 +1,5 @@ > include $(top_srcdir)/Makefile.inc > -LIB = $(top_builddir)/lib > - > -dist_pkgdata_DATA = $(LIB)/libodp.la > - > -pkgconfigdir = $(libdir)/pkgconfig > -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c > - > -.PHONY: pkgconfig/libodp.pc > +include $(top_srcdir)/platform/Makefile.inc > > PLAT_CFLAGS = -msse4.2 > if SDK_INSTALL_PATH_ > @@ -25,8 +18,6 @@ A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include > A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include/api > AM_CFLAGS += -I$(top_srcdir)/include > > -VPATH = $(srcdir) $(builddir) > -lib_LTLIBRARIES = $(LIB)/libodp.la > DPDK_LIBS="-lintel_dpdk -ldl" > LIBS += $(DPDK_LIBS) > > diff --git a/platform/linux-generic/Makefile.am b/platform/linux-generic/Makefile.am > index 91a208a..41458d8 100644 > --- a/platform/linux-generic/Makefile.am > +++ b/platform/linux-generic/Makefile.am > @@ -1,18 +1,9 @@ > include $(top_srcdir)/Makefile.inc > -LIB = $(top_builddir)/lib > - > -dist_pkgdata_DATA = $(LIB)/libodp.la > - > -pkgconfigdir = $(libdir)/pkgconfig > -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c > - > -.PHONY: pkgconfig/libodp.pc > +include $(top_srcdir)/platform/Makefile.inc > > AM_CFLAGS += -I$(srcdir)/include > AM_CFLAGS += -I$(srcdir)/include/api > AM_CFLAGS += -I$(top_srcdir)/include > -VPATH = $(srcdir) $(builddir) > -lib_LTLIBRARIES = $(LIB)/libodp.la > > include_HEADERS = \ > $(top_srcdir)/include/odp.h \ > diff --git a/platform/linux-keystone2/Makefile.am b/platform/linux-keystone2/Makefile.am > index 3d48b54..b32c539 100644 > --- a/platform/linux-keystone2/Makefile.am > +++ b/platform/linux-keystone2/Makefile.am > @@ -1,12 +1,5 @@ > include $(top_srcdir)/Makefile.inc > -LIB = $(top_builddir)/lib > - > -dist_pkgdata_DATA = $(LIB)/libodp.la > - > -pkgconfigdir = $(libdir)/pkgconfig > -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c > - > -.PHONY: pkgconfig/libodp.pc > +include $(top_srcdir)/platform/Makefile.inc > > KS2_PLATFORM = DEVICE_K2K > if SDK_INSTALL_PATH_ > @@ -28,8 +21,6 @@ AM_CFLAGS += -I$(srcdir)/include/api > A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include > A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include/api > AM_CFLAGS += -I$(top_srcdir)/include > -VPATH = $(srcdir) $(builddir) > -lib_LTLIBRARIES = $(LIB)/libodp.la > KS2_LIBS="-lopenem_rh -lopenem_osal" > LIBS += $(KS2_LIBS) >
diff --git a/platform/Makefile.inc b/platform/Makefile.inc new file mode 100644 index 0000000..6ffa2ad --- /dev/null +++ b/platform/Makefile.inc @@ -0,0 +1,11 @@ +LIB = $(top_builddir)/lib + +dist_pkgdata_DATA = $(LIB)/libodp.la + +pkgconfigdir = $(libdir)/pkgconfig +p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c + +.PHONY: pkgconfig/libodp.pc + +VPATH = $(srcdir) $(builddir) +lib_LTLIBRARIES = $(LIB)/libodp.la diff --git a/platform/linux-dpdk/Makefile.am b/platform/linux-dpdk/Makefile.am index 37150f2..fb87d41 100644 --- a/platform/linux-dpdk/Makefile.am +++ b/platform/linux-dpdk/Makefile.am @@ -1,12 +1,5 @@ include $(top_srcdir)/Makefile.inc -LIB = $(top_builddir)/lib - -dist_pkgdata_DATA = $(LIB)/libodp.la - -pkgconfigdir = $(libdir)/pkgconfig -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c - -.PHONY: pkgconfig/libodp.pc +include $(top_srcdir)/platform/Makefile.inc PLAT_CFLAGS = -msse4.2 if SDK_INSTALL_PATH_ @@ -25,8 +18,6 @@ A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include/api AM_CFLAGS += -I$(top_srcdir)/include -VPATH = $(srcdir) $(builddir) -lib_LTLIBRARIES = $(LIB)/libodp.la DPDK_LIBS="-lintel_dpdk -ldl" LIBS += $(DPDK_LIBS) diff --git a/platform/linux-generic/Makefile.am b/platform/linux-generic/Makefile.am index 91a208a..41458d8 100644 --- a/platform/linux-generic/Makefile.am +++ b/platform/linux-generic/Makefile.am @@ -1,18 +1,9 @@ include $(top_srcdir)/Makefile.inc -LIB = $(top_builddir)/lib - -dist_pkgdata_DATA = $(LIB)/libodp.la - -pkgconfigdir = $(libdir)/pkgconfig -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c - -.PHONY: pkgconfig/libodp.pc +include $(top_srcdir)/platform/Makefile.inc AM_CFLAGS += -I$(srcdir)/include AM_CFLAGS += -I$(srcdir)/include/api AM_CFLAGS += -I$(top_srcdir)/include -VPATH = $(srcdir) $(builddir) -lib_LTLIBRARIES = $(LIB)/libodp.la include_HEADERS = \ $(top_srcdir)/include/odp.h \ diff --git a/platform/linux-keystone2/Makefile.am b/platform/linux-keystone2/Makefile.am index 3d48b54..b32c539 100644 --- a/platform/linux-keystone2/Makefile.am +++ b/platform/linux-keystone2/Makefile.am @@ -1,12 +1,5 @@ include $(top_srcdir)/Makefile.inc -LIB = $(top_builddir)/lib - -dist_pkgdata_DATA = $(LIB)/libodp.la - -pkgconfigdir = $(libdir)/pkgconfig -pkgconfig_DATA = $(top_builddir)/pkgconfig/libodp.pc - -.PHONY: pkgconfig/libodp.pc +include $(top_srcdir)/platform/Makefile.inc KS2_PLATFORM = DEVICE_K2K if SDK_INSTALL_PATH_ @@ -28,8 +21,6 @@ AM_CFLAGS += -I$(srcdir)/include/api A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include AM_CFLAGS += -I$(top_srcdir)/platform/linux-generic/include/api AM_CFLAGS += -I$(top_srcdir)/include -VPATH = $(srcdir) $(builddir) -lib_LTLIBRARIES = $(LIB)/libodp.la KS2_LIBS="-lopenem_rh -lopenem_osal" LIBS += $(KS2_LIBS)
Signed-off-by: Anders Roxell <anders.roxell@linaro.org> --- platform/Makefile.inc | 11 +++++++++++ platform/linux-dpdk/Makefile.am | 11 +---------- platform/linux-generic/Makefile.am | 11 +---------- platform/linux-keystone2/Makefile.am | 11 +---------- 4 files changed, 14 insertions(+), 30 deletions(-) create mode 100644 platform/Makefile.inc